Method 2: Screen Mirroring from Phone or PC

If private channels are not an option, screen mirroring is a reliable alternative. Both Roku and modern smartphones/PCs support Miracast or AirPlay. Simply install the IPTV app (like TiviMate or IPTV Smarters) on your phone, log in to 8K IPTV, and mirror your screen to the Roku. This works for watching live TV, but you'll need to keep your device on and connected. For sports like NFL or UFC, this is a solid workaround.

One downside is that screen mirroring can be less stable and may introduce lag. To minimize issues, use a 5GHz Wi-Fi network and keep your phone close to the Roku. Also, some Roku models handle mirroring better than others—Roku Ultra and Streaming Stick+ are recommended.
